SUBANG JAYA (Nov 24): Sime Darby Property, the property arm of Sime Darby Bhd, recently saw strong take-up at the launch of its new condominium development dubbed Isola in Subang, Selangor on Nov 11. During the launch, 75% of the 115 units open for sale were taken up by a mix of home buyers and investors.  

Located along Jalan SS16/1 in Subang, the development is situated on 2.17 acres of freehold land and has a gross development value (GDV) of RM220 million. With two 16-storey towers that house 216 units of apartments, the units have a built-up area of between 1,023 sq ft to 4,133 sq ft, with a starting price of RM679,888. Out of the 115 units that were made available during the launch, 85 units had been purchased within hours of the launch.

Visitors view the display models during the launch.Facilities for Isola include a resort-themed podium, swimming pool, playground, multi-purpose hall, gymnasium and mini forest. Isola — which means "Island" in Italian — is located in a central location, with access to major highways and transportation hubs as well as established business districts including private medical and public facilities.
